SOS may not come with a DVD, but it does refer to online content in some articles; that could be a benefit to your space saving ethos. What SOS also provide is their entire history of articles (or most of it) on their website. They are commonly known by the acronym 'SOS' (as you can see here). So, if you're ever looking around for something on a search engine - details on mastering, for example - then you can suffix your search with 'SOS', and you should end up with a Sound On Sound article on that subject (unless it hasn't already been written). At the risk of sounding like I work for SOS (which I don't!) the other thing they do is sell all the backissues as PDFs on CD-ROMS giving you full searchable access to all their articles. I currently have every issue from 1998-2004 on their CD-ROMS... brilliant resource.
